Report: Siena Coach Investigated For Verbally Abusing Team Manager With Mental Disorder

Siena College men's basketball coach Jimmy Patsos is reportedly being investigated by the university due to allegations that he verbally abused a team student-manager who has a mental disorder, according to Rick Karlin of the Times Union.

A spokeswoman for the university confirmed the investigation to the Times Union. No specific details about the investigation and allegations were provided.

Several players have been interviewed by an external attorney retained by the school and a Title IX coordinator.

The student manager is a sophomore who has been diagnosed with obsessive compulsive disorder. Patsos reportedly referred to the student as "the next Unabomber.
